Step 3: Design

I started by designing the case in Fusion 360

  • I put holes in the case for the wires, button, battery, and motor.
  • I designed a button making a cylinder then filleting the top outside
  • cut a square hole in that to clip into the button
  • made a spinner with thin walls that bend and slightly wider top allowing a tight fit on the chalk
  • added hole for 9 volt clip

Step 4: Assembling

I put everything inside the case. Glued clip into case. Soldered wires from the battery to the button to the motor.
